BPCL contract tanker drivers launch flash strike in Kerala

Over 250 gasoline tank drivers contracted by Bharat Petroleum Corporation Limited (BPCL) for supplying gasoline throughout Kerala have gone on a flash strike, refusing to load gasoline from the corporate’s Irumbanam plant on Monday. They are demanding speedy implementation of beneficial phrases.

At current, solely transporters engaged instantly by sellers are filling gasoline on the plant. The protesting drivers will not be affiliated with any commerce union. The preliminary spherical of discussions with BPCL representatives ended inconclusively. Drivers have submitted a 17-point constitution of calls for, which firm sources mentioned is into account to resolve the stalemate.

“Fuel filling on the plant has not been affected as sellers are taking supply. Only contracted transporters are on strike,” firm sources mentioned.

Demands

Among the calls for raised by the drivers are issuing payments for filling earlier than 3 p.m. and finishing billing earlier than 5 p.m., together with resolving current points associated to delays. “We report on the plant at 6 a.m. to take gasoline hundreds. Thereafter, we’re made to attend for hours earlier than the load is stuffed within the night. We then must drive in a single day to ship the availability with out ample relaxation, which is harmful contemplating the extremely hazardous cargo we transport. The identical routine repeats the subsequent day after we report within the morning,” mentioned driver Fazak Pookkoya Thangal.

The drivers additionally demand an finish to alleged impolite behaviour by safety guards and workplace employees. They need preparations to make sure deliveries nearer to their houses on Saturdays. Drivers ought to be allowed to help in filling if there’s a employees scarcity within the part. Delays in issuing invoices ought to be averted, they mentioned.

They additional insist there ought to be no discrimination between tankers operated by sellers and people contracted. The follow of filling on Sundays to compensate for public holidays ought to be stopped. Deliveries ought to be assigned in a method that ensures that every one transporters cowl related distances since pay relies on kilometres travelled. Resting services ought to be supplied on the parking zone, with safety guards deployed if crucial, based on the constitution of calls for.
